What are the vaccination requirements for my pet to attend daycare in Cando?
For the safety of all pets, most daycares in Cando require proof of up-to-date vaccinations. This typically includes Rabies, DHPP (for dogs),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Due to our rural location and local wildlife, facilities are particularly strict about rabies. You'll need to provide records from your local vet, such as Cando Veterinary Clinic or a clinic from a neighboring town.
How much does pet daycare typically cost in Cando, ND?
Given Cando's small-town economy, pet daycare is generally affordable. You can expect to pay approximately $18 to $25 for a full day of daycare for one dog. Some facilities may offer discounted multi-day packages or reduced rates for a second pet from the same household. Always check if pricing differs for cats or other small animals.
How should I prepare my pet for their first day of daycare?
To ensure a smooth first day, bring your pet on a secure leash or in a carrier. You must provide your vet's contact information and an emergency local contact. Given Cando's extreme weather, bring appropriate gearβa coat for winter or a cooling mat for summer heat isn't a bad idea. Also, pack their lunch if they require a specific feeding schedule.

Are there any local considerations for pet daycare in a small town like Cando?
Yes, Cando's rural nature means a few things for pet owners. Daycare hours may be more limited and often require advanced booking, as capacity is smaller than in big cities. Be aware that many services are multi-purpose, often combined with grooming or boarding, so confirm the specific activities for the 'daycare' portion. Also, ask about their protocol for severe weather common to the area, like winter blizzards or summer storms.
